Monsquaz foundation member dusthillguy has been working on a BASIC program for the BBC Microcomputer system, a microcomputer which was popular in the 1980s. This program draws a picture on the screen in the BBC microcomputer's graphics mode 1, which has a resolution of 320x256 with 4 colours. With help from users of the Stardot forum, the program was optimised. A picture that would have taken 60 seconds to draw now takes only 56 seconds.
